Opsigo Lumina 2025: Advancing the Travel Ecosystem Through Technology and Collaboration
A celebration that brings together travel agents, corporate partners, and distribution partners to honor shared achievements while strengthening collaboration and driving digital transformation across the travel industry.
Jakarta, Wednesday, 10 December 2025 — JW Marriott Hotel Jakarta.
Opsigo hosted Opsigo Lumina 2025, an appreciation and collaboration event that brought together key players in the travel ecosystem—including travel agencies, corporate clients, distribution partners, and technology providers. Lumina serves as Opsigo’s expression of gratitude for the trust and partnerships that have supported the company’s innovation journey and growth throughout the years.
This year marks an important milestone for Opsigo. With expanded technology integrations, enhanced platform capabilities, and strengthened partnerships, Opsigo Lumina 2025 becomes a stage to reaffirm Opsigo’s commitment to building a more efficient, connected, and future-ready travel ecosystem.
Tech Talk: Exploring the Future of the Travel Industry
To open the evening, Opsigo Lumina 2025 set the stage through a series of Tech Talk sessions that explored the future direction of the travel industry, highlighting how collaboration and technology continue to reshape the ecosystem.

Session 1 — Driving Collaboration & Digital Transformation in the Travel Industry
In this session, Edward Jusuf, CEO of Opsigo, together with Evalany from Antavaya and M. Indharto from Patra Jasa, discussed how cross-industry collaboration plays a crucial role in accelerating travel digitalization. The session was moderated by Vitri Zulianti, GM of Synergy MDI, who brought additional insight into ecosystem synergy and operational innovation.

Session 2 — Futureproofing Travel: Innovation, Security & Seamless Experiences
The second session highlighted the importance of continuous innovation and digital security in navigating the complexities of today’s travel industry. Abdul Azis from CloudMile and Djoko Mulyono from Tokio Marine shared insights on building smoother, safer, and more integrated travel experiences. The discussion was moderated by Ksatriya Anantayutya, Head of Commercial at Opsigo.

Recognizing Our Partners: Celebrating Collective Progress
Following the Tech Talk sessions, Opsigo Lumina 2025 continued with an appreciation segment honoring partners who have played a major role in advancing digital transformation within the travel industry. These awards reflect a shared journey between Opsigo and industry stakeholders in building a more modern and integrated ecosystem.
Digital Travel Transformation Award — Travel Agencies
Antavaya, Mitra Tours & Travel, Astrindo, Mytours, Obaja Tour & Travel, HIS Travel, Golden Rama, Golden Nusa, Bayu Buana, and Aero Globe Indonesia received recognition for their commitment to adopting technology and enhancing operational efficiency through Opsigo. Their efforts have significantly accelerated the digitalization of travel services in Indonesia.
Top Performing Corporate — Corporate Clients
Pertamina, BRI, and Unilever were recognized for their optimization of Opsigo and Opsicorp in managing business travel with greater structure, transparency, and efficiency.
Top-performing Insurance — Insurance Partners
Zurich, Sompo, and Tokio Marine were honored for providing competitive and integrated travel protection services, as well as contributing to the growth of insurance policy transactions through Opsigo. Strong product integration and a smoother purchasing flow enhanced user experience in the area of travel safety.
Transportation Excellence Recognition — Airline Partners
Lion Air, Garuda Indonesia, and Citilink received recognition for supporting the growth of flight transactions through stable, accurate, and easily accessible content integration. Their contributions ensure broad route availability and seamless booking experiences for both travel agencies and corporate clients.
Excellence in Accommodation Distribution — Accommodation & Distribution Partners
MG, Kliknbook, and WebBeds were acknowledged for expanding accommodation availability, improving hotel content quality, and contributing significant transaction volume within the Opsigo ecosystem. Their strong distribution integrations enable travel agencies to access more competitive and diverse hotel options.
